Head of Commercial Strategy
We are partnering with an ambitious and rapidly growing health and wellbeing software provider to appoint a Head of Commercial Strategy to lead the development and commercialisation of a new B2C proposition.
The business is developing a bespoke digital application designed to help people stay healthier, better understand their health and take greater control of their own wellbeing. This is a pivotal leadership opportunity for someone who can take a proposition from strategy through to market and build a commercially successful new business stream.
As Head of Commercial Strategy, you will have ownership of the commercial strategy, go-to-market and P&L for the new proposition.
Working closely with the existing Product, Marketing and Engineering teams, you will bring together the capabilities already within the organisation to define the proposition, establish product-market fit, develop acquisition strategies and build the partnerships required to scale.

This is a highly hands-on role, requiring someone who can operate strategically while also driving execution.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and own the commercial strategy for the new B2C proposition
- Take the proposition from concept through go-to-market and commercial launch
- Own the P&L, revenue strategy and commercial performance
- Define pricing, positioning, packaging and routes to market
- Develop and execute customer acquisition and growth strategies
- Identify, build and manage strategic partnership opportunities
- Work closely with Product, Marketing and Engineering to ensure the proposition meets genuine customer needs
- Build and develop the commercial team as the proposition scales
Requirements
We’re looking for a commercially minded leader with experience of building and scaling digital propositions, ideally within health, wellbeing, healthcare technology, SaaS, consumer technology or a similarly data-driven environment.

You’ll be someone who can move comfortably between strategy and execution and has a proven ability to turn an idea or proposition into a commercially viable product.
You’ll ideally bring:
- Proven experience in commercial strategy, growth or go-to-market leadership
- Experience launching and scaling a B2C digital product or proposition
- Strong understanding of customer acquisition, retention and growth
- Experience owning a P&L and commercial targets
- A strong track record of developing strategic partnerships
- Experience building and leading commercial teams
- The ability to work cross-functionally with Product, Marketing and Engineering
- Strong commercial judgement and analytical capability
- An entrepreneurial mindset with the ability to operate in a fast-moving environment
